[Hormonal regulation of uterine contraction]
Abstract:
A personal method has been used to study spontaneous kinetic activity of the uterus in 50 women during puerperium following miscarriage between the VIIIth and XIIth weeks. Modifications induced were evaluated in several sessions (510 recordings) and at various periods of time, following administration of: 50 mg of 17B oestradiol, 200 mg natural progesterone, 500 mg of natural progesterone, 250 mg of 17 hydroxyprogesterone caproate and 500 mg of 17 hydroxyprogesterone caproate. In the case of some of the patients, hysterotonometry was evaluated following intravenous oxytocin loading. The results pointed to an activation of the uterine pacemaker after oestrogenic loading, and a clear-cut progestinic block of contractile activity.

Hormonal Regulation of the Menstrual Cycle
At puberty, GnRH begins a pulsatile release pattern, which triggers the anterior pituitary gland to secrete follicle-stimulating hormone (FSH) and luteinizing hormone (LH). The frequency and amplitude of GnRH pulses vary across the menstrual cycle, with faster pulses favoring LH release and slower pulses favoring FSH release.
